Does bandwidth between droplets using private ip’s count against you?

No it does not - Only data transfer on the public network interface will count against your bandwidth allowance.
From the documentation:
Any data transfer sent by a Droplet using a public network interface will count against the transfer pool for that Droplet’s account. All IPv6 traffic uses the public interface. Data transfer between Droplets over the VPC network uses a private network interface.
